Introduction of EU Driving Licenses
An EU driving license is a standardized document that permits people to run automobile across all member states of the European Union. Presented to promote mobility and streamline driving guidelines, the EU license makes sure that holders satisfy specific proficiency requirements.

4. License Categories
The EU driving license is divided into a number of classifications, each permitting the holder to run particular types of automobiles. Here's a breakdown of typical classifications:

Q4: Are there any age restrictions for various automobile categories?
Yes, each category has a minimum age requirement, with the most typical being 18 for Category B (vehicles) and 21 for Category C (trucks).
